My design is rooted in sustainable practice and craftsmanship, exploring ways flowers can be used beyond the vase. Since beginning preparations for the show last year, I have grown many of the flowers from seed and incorporated them throughout the design in a variety of forms, such as dehydrated, pressed for culinary use, made into confetti, transformed into natural dyes for the cushions, and used to create cyanotype printed artwork.
Strawberry plants have been propagated from runners and grown on especially for the show, alongside Nasturtiums grown from seed, adding an edible and seasonal element to the tablescape. Fresh seasonal flowers grown by myself, alongside blooms sourced from a local flower farmer, bringing the tablescape to life and celebrate the beauty of British-grown flowers and seasonal abundance.
